Chester Gift Card

Chester's popular gift card scheme has seen the city's economy boosted to the tune of over £100,000.

Designers Chester BID are celebrating after The Chester Gift Card hit £100,000 in sales, however it is estimated that the impact could be greater still.

More than 125 businesses, from independents and large retailers to restaurants and experiences have benefitted, with many reporting an overspend since it was launched in November 2020.

One of the businesses that have taken part in the scheme is Lakeland, on Northgate Street.
